White Winds (Seeker's Journey) is the fourth studio album by Swiss harpist Andreas Vollenweider, released in 1984. It remains one of his most celebrated works, selling over 1.5 million units worldwide and blending world music influences from Asia and the Orient with his signature electric harp sound.
